The Rambla: Automatic Telescopic Bollard is an automatic hydraulic bollard designed for access control on public roads, communities, and companies. It features a satin-finish AISI-304 stainless steel plunger with dimensions of Ø220 x 600mm height and 8mm thickness. The bollard includes a surface cover, chassis, fasteners, and stainless steel screws for enhanced strength and durability. Its control panel unit is housed in a lockable, watertight metal cabinet, which contains a programmable PLC and protective measures. The design incorporates immediate safety responses for vehicles; when a magnetic loop detects a car or motorcycle, the bollard lowers automatically. For people or other obstacles, a pressure sensor triggers the bollard to lower at the slightest sign of impact. Its design, without internal guides, prevents jamming problems, and the top location of the electrical mechanism protects components from water contact. The Rambla bollard holds an APPLUS impact certificate, based on PAS 68 regulations.
Property | Pilona Rambla 600 (H6008R) | Pilona Rambla 750 (H7508R) |
---|---|---|
Height from Ground Level | 600 mm | 750 mm |
Bollard Diameter | Ø220 mm | Ø220 mm |
Bollard Thickness | 8 mm | 8 mm |
Bollard Material | Stainless steel AISI 304 satin finish | Stainless steel AISI 304 satin finish |
Motor Power | 230V 50Hz, 300W (3,000rpm) | 230V 50Hz, 300W (3,000RPM) |
Temperature Range | -20°C to +80°C | -20°C to +80°C |
IP Protection Rating | IP67 | IP67 |
Working Frequency | 1400 Nw | 1400 Nw |
Ascent Time | 3-4 seconds | 3-4 seconds |
Lowering Time | 3-4 seconds | 3-4 seconds |
Control Panel | BC20 | BC20 |
Impact Resistance | 250,000 Joules | 250,000 Joules |
Reflective Band | Optional | Optional |
Safety of People and Property | Optional | Optional |
Lighted Crown | Yes, LED RGB | Yes, LED RGB |
Traffic Light Function | Yes | Yes |
